Wechsel vom Datums- und Stundenformat zum numerischen Format

8

Ich arbeite in R und muss von einer Spalte im Format

wechseln %Vor%

zu einem Wertformat. In Excel kann ich die Funktion value() verwenden, aber ich weiß nicht, wie man es in R macht.

Meine Daten sehen folgendermaßen aus:

%Vor%     
Joshua Ulrich 21.11.2011, 16:51
quelle

2 Antworten

22

Um eine Zeichenkette in das R-Datumsformat zu konvertieren, verwenden Sie as.POSIXct - dann können Sie sie mit as.numeric :

zu einem numerischen Wert erzwingen %Vor%

Der Wert, den Sie erhalten, gibt die Anzahl der Sekunden seit einem beliebigen Datum an, normalerweise 1/1/1970. Beachten Sie, dass sich dies von Excel unterscheidet, wo ein Datum als die Anzahl der Tage seit einem beliebigen Datum gespeichert wird (1/1/1900, wenn mein Gedächtnis mir gut tut - ich versuche, Excel nicht mehr zu verwenden.)

Weitere Informationen finden Sie unter ?DateTimeClasses

    
Andrie 21.11.2011 17:04
quelle
3

Das war nützlich für mich:

%Vor%

Sie können ähnliche Ansätze verwenden, wenn Sie Tagnummern wie in Excel benötigen.

    
Matthias Wuttke 15.10.2013 09:08
quelle

Tags und Links